Key learning pointsUnder tough market conditions, Ian Newton's business was suffering from under investment, whilst Andy Shaw's business was suffering from too much investment in a new parlour and increased cow numbers. Both felt their businesses were unsustainable going forward.
They formed a formal joint partnership, bringing both farms and herds together now totalling 500 cows. Pooling capital, labour and stock the group greatly improved efficiencies and performance; production costs were reduced by 2ppl and milking time was reduced by over 50% each day.
For Ian and Andy, the key ingredients for success in the partnership include a strong working relationship, an open mind and plenty of outside help from consultants and bank managers.
